Transaction 51afa2910ee2936f63c447920ab4bb33a66d3eddd5f7895a920e4abdcffbdd1e

1 Input
2 Outputs
  • 51afa2910ee2936f63c447920ab4bb33a66d3eddd5f7895a920e4abdcffbdd1e:0
  • value  41642
    address  3NaA8ivdAnecWMg8z6R7c5kiaARUh81a6b
  • 51afa2910ee2936f63c447920ab4bb33a66d3eddd5f7895a920e4abdcffbdd1e:1
  • value  10370125
    address  bc1q453ssvwx5nx5m65t6jfu3qdhrurt9w3x5mqwjk